Hi Paul,

if you're using GR 3.7, the "standard" blocks have moved from the /gr/ module 
to the /blocks/ module.
If you're using 3.6, further investigation is necessary.

On 10/21/2013 01:45 AM, Paul B. Huter wrote:
I looked everywhere for information pertaining to this question, but nothing 
worked.

I am starting with a sample for recording information from my USRP (N210), but 
I am running into issues with:

self.gr_file_sink = gr.file_sink(gr.sizeof_complex, "data.dat")

When I try running it, I get:

A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'file_sink'

Where am I going wrong? Is this an issue with my installation, something to do 
with C++/Python configuration? I followed the instructions for setup from Ettus 
(http://code.ettus.com/redmine/ettus/projects/uhd/wiki/GNURadio_Windows).

I was having issues with WX on GNURadio-Companion (Windows), and I cannot get 
my network configured for Linux, so I resorted to a Python script in Windows.
